*MED-EL Honours Sunshine's Young Innovators*

Today Wednesday 19th February 2025, Sunshine Nursery and Primary School welcomed MED-EL's Marketing Officer, Ms. Abigeal Oluwadamilola Akinade, accompanied by Dr. Kunle Adeyemo and Dr. Ayodeji from the Department of Otorhinolaryngology, Obafemi Awolowo University. They presented Certificates of Participation to our talented young Innovators; PearI Adebusuyi, Toyosi Olawumi, Darasimi Oyetunji-Alemede and Salvation Nengou Deogracias who participated in the global _Ideas4Ears_ contest.

Ms. Akinade expressed MED-EL's admiration for Sunshine's innovative designs, highlighting their originality, functionality, and exceptional quality. She revealed that Sunshine's entries stood out among participants from seven African countries and six Nigerian states.

Dr. Kunle Adeyemo shared insightful stories about children with hearing disabilities, emphasizing the need for innovative solutions. He encouraged our young innovators to pursue careers in medicine and invention, inspiring positive change.

The event featured a showcase of each participant's design, demonstrating their creativity and problem-solving skills. After which the presentation of certificates and gifts was done.
Parents of Sunshine's young innovators, their teachers, and a few guests were impressed by the children's confidence and innovative thinking.

Aunty Bisi thanked MED-EL for their kind gesture, acknowledging the winning entry's exceptional quality. She expressed enthusiasm for the next competition, promising to prepare our children for an even more challenging contest. She also commended Uncle Wale and Uncle Timothy for their guidance and challenging each innovator explore their creativity and grasp the essence of the competition so well.

The event concluded with a lively photo shoot and a sense of pride and accomplishment. Despite Uncle Timothy's absence, his hard work and dedication to the children's projects were deeply appreciated.

This event celebrated the power of innovation, creativity, and collaboration, inspiring Sunshine's young minds to continue making a positive impact.

Sunshine Nursery and Primary School's 2024-25 Relay Team Makes a Thrilling Debut!

Today, our tiny but mighty relay team faced off against seven other schools at the Unifemiga Nursery and Primary School invitation relay. Despite being the smallest team, they showed remarkable determination and spirit!

Running on the prestigious Obafemi Awolowo Sports tracks, our young athletes held their own against taller and more experienced opponents. The boys' team clinched an impressive third position, while the girls' team finished fifth, overcoming a technical hitch during the baton passing.

Special kudos to Nanaya Ansa and Kemi Jacob, who demonstrated exceptional skill and perseverance in their respective legs of the race!

We also extend our heartfelt appreciation to Uncle Tomiwa, our dedicated and exceptional coach, who has superbly guided our relay team for the past 7 years. Your tireless efforts, expertise, and passion for athletics have been instrumental in shaping our young athletes into confident and skilled competitors. Thank you for your commitment to excellence!

We couldn't be prouder of our debutants! Their courage, teamwork, and sportsmanship are a shining example of the Sunshine spirit. Congratulations to our fantastic relay team!
